Tian‐Zi Shen is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ials and Electrical and Electronic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Tian‐Zi Shen has authored 40 papers receiving a total of 938 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Materials Chemistry, 20 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ials and 18 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ering. Recurrent topics in Tian‐Zi Shen's work include Liquid Crystal Research Advancements (14 papers), Graphene research and applications (11 papers) and Photonic Crystals and Applications (10 papers). Tian‐Zi Shen is often cited by papers focused on Liquid Crystal Research Advancements (14 papers), Graphene research and applications (11 papers) and Photonic Crystals and Applications (10 papers). Tian‐Zi Shen coll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, China and Pakistan. Tian‐Zi Shen's co-authors include Jang‐Kun Song, Seung‐Ho Hong, Bomi Lee, Won Jong Yoo, Daeyeong Lee, Chang‐Ho Ra, Jae‐Young Choi, Amir Shahzad, Sukho Song and Sangsoo Kim and has published in prestigious journals such as Advanced Materials, Nature Materials and ACS Nano.
